Todd Spangler NY Digital EditorMembers of the union representing about 100 editorial staffers at G/O Media publications — including Jezebel, The Root, Lifehacker, Kotaku, Jalopnik and Gizmodo — have gone on strike after its contract with the company expired Monday at midnight.Gizmodo Media Group Union, organized with the Writers Guild of America, East, unanimously approved the strike (with 93% of members voting) after the union’s second contract expired Feb. 28.
Members of the GMG Union began picketing outside G/O Media’s offices at 1290 Avenue of the Americas in New York City on Tuesday.In a statement, the GMG Union said, “In 2015, this union broke new ground when it organized the first digital media union. Now, GMG Union will break ground yet again: We are the first digital media shop to go on an open-ended strike for a fair contract.” In a memo to G/O Media staff, CEO Jim Spanfeller wrote that he was “disappointed we could not come to terms on the current GMG Union contract.
We bargained in good faith right up until the deadline late last night when the Union voted to cut off talks and strike.” Spanfeller claimed that the terms G/O Media offered the union were “not only equivalent to, but in some instances better than, terms agreed to by The Onion Union (GMG’s sister union here at G/O) just one year ago.”“We are struggling to understand why terms agreed to by half the editorial union members last year are not acceptable to the other half now,” Spanfeller wrote in the memo. “Unfortunately, that puts G/O Media in an untenable position with regard to these current negotiations.”G/O Media was formed in 2019 after Univision sold Gizmodo Media Group and The Onion to private-equity firm Great Hill Partners and Spanfeller,

EXCLUSIVE: Matt Bomer is in early talks to join the cast of the upcoming Netflix Leonard Bernstein biopic Maestro, which has Bradley Cooper directing and starring as the iconic composer. If a deal closes, Bomer joins Carey Mulligan, who will play Bernstein’s wife Felicia. Pic will be produced by Martin Scorsese, Steven Spielberg, Cooper and his Joint Effort producing partner Todd Phillips, Kristie Macosko Krieger, Emma Tillinger Koskoff, and Fred Berner and Amy Durning.

Following a six-day strike and four days of picketing in New York City, WGA East members have voted near-unanimously to ratify a new contract with G/O Media covering about 100 staffers at its digital news outlets Gizmodo, Jezebel, The Root, Lifehacker, Kotaku and Jalopnik.
The WGA East’s strike against the Gizmodo Media Group has ended after an agreement was reached on a new contract covering nearly 100 staffers at G/O Media news outlets Gizmodo, Jezebel, The Root, Lifehacker, Kotaku and Jalopnik. Picket lines had gone up outside the parent company’s offices in New York City on Tuesday morning. The tentative agreement now goes to the guild’s Council for approval, and to the bargaining unit for ratification.
